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our technicians will conduct a thorough inspection of your property to identify the source and extent of the sewage backup.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ect any hidden damage or contamination.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action for extraction and restoration.

Step 2: Sewage Water Extraction

Using our powerful pumps and specialized equipment, we’ll extract the sewage water from your property. This may involve removing wet carpet, padding, and flooring materials to prevent further damage.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your property back to normal as quickly as possible.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the sewage water has been extracted, we’ll focus on drying and dehumidifying your property. This involves using specialized equipment to remove any remaining moisture and prevent mold growth. Our team will work to restore your property to a safe and healthy condition.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ection

After the drying process is complete, we’ll clean and disinfect your property to remove any remaining sewage residue and bacteria. This is a critical step in preventing health risks and ensuring your property is safe for occupancy.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Finally, our team will work with you to restore and reconstruct your property to its original condition. This may involve replacing damaged flooring, walls, and other materials. We’ll work with you to ensure that your property is restored to its original condition, or better.

Sewage Water Extraction Cost in Ellijay, GA

The cost of sewage water extraction in Ellijay, GA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ices are transparent and fair, and we guarantee your satisfaction with our work. Here’s a breakdown of typical costs: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Sewage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of drying process
Cleaning and Disinfection $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of cleaning and disinfection needed, and equipment required
Restoration and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and complexity of restoration work

Common Questions About Sewage Water Extraction

Is sewage water extraction covered by insurance?

Yes, sewage water extraction is usually covered by homeowner’s insurance. But, coverage and deductibles may vary depending on your policy and provider. Our team will work with you to find out the extent of your coverage and provide a plan for payment and restoration.

How long does sewage water extraction take?

The length of time for sewage water extraction depends on the size of the affected area and the severity of the damage.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your property back to normal as quickly as possible. Typically, extraction and drying can take anywhere from a few hours to several days.

Is sewage water extraction a health risk?

Yes, sewage water can pose a significant health risk due to the presence of bacteria, viruses, and other contaminants. Our team will take every precaution to ensure your safety and health during the extraction and restoration process.
